Transaction 75fd9640e4c2aff91fb9d179ff3a80556ecdb7bd6ff64b169c68d5da46306ccc
1 Input
1 Output
-
75fd9640e4c2aff91fb9d179ff3a80556ecdb7bd6ff64b169c68d5da46306ccc:0
- value
- 1038061
- script pubkey
- OP_0 OP_PUSHBYTES_20 de14851ef5a8472ac668fc1e0fa1a0c95b08ea7c
- address
- bc1qmc2g28h44prj43ngls0qlgdqe9ds36nuywxq5w